Grill Cleaning and Restoration for Wilton's Wooded Properties
Wilton sits in a quieter, more residential pocket of Fairfield County where homes are set back on larger wooded lots. Grilling here is a private, backyard ritual — no spectacle, just a good meal cooked outside under the trees. But that wooded environment creates maintenance challenges that suburban and coastal towns do not face. Pollen blankets every surface in spring. Fallen leaves and acorns collect inside uncovered grills in autumn. And spiders nest in the sheltered warmth of burner tubes twelve months a year.
Because Wilton properties are more spread out and private, some homeowners let their grills go longer between cleanings than they realize. A grill that has sat through two or three seasons without professional attention can have inches of hardened carbon on the firebox walls, completely blocked burner ports, and a grease management system that is a fire risk. Wilton Homeowner Questions
My grill has been sitting unused for two full seasons. Is it worth cleaning or should I replace it?
In most cases, a professional cleaning is all it needs. We have restored grills that homeowners were ready to discard. A Full Restoration costs a fraction of a new grill and usually gets it back to near-original performance. If we find structural damage that is beyond repair, we will tell you upfront so you are not paying for a cleaning that will not hold.
Do you clean natural gas grills that are connected to a house gas line?
Yes. We clean natural gas grills in place without disconnecting the supply line. We work carefully around the connection, clean all accessible components, and verify everything is secure and functional when we are done.
What time of year should Wilton homeowners schedule a cleaning?
April is ideal — after the heaviest pollen has settled but before Memorial Day weekend. This gives you a fully restored grill right as the grilling season begins. If your grill sees heavy summer use, a second cleaning in October prepares it for winter storage or year-round use.
Will you flag anything dangerous during the cleaning?
Absolutely. We inspect every component as we clean. If we find a cracked gas line connector, a corroded burner with holes, or any condition that poses a safety risk, we will stop and show you before proceeding. Your safety matters more than finishing the job.
